Applied Behavior Analysis is the 155th most popular major in the country with 5,459 degrees awarded in 2021-2022.
Across Illinois, there were 59 applied behavior analysis graduates with average earnings and debt of $0 and $0 respectively. At the doctor’s degree level specifically, there were 2 applied behavior analysis graduates with average earnings and debt of $82,783 and $153,500 respectively.

Top 1 Most Focused Doctor’s Degree Colleges for Applied Behavior Analysis in Illinois
You’ll join some of the best and brightest minds around if you attend The Chicago School of Professional Psychology at Chicago. The school came in at #1 for the Schools for a Doctorate Highly Focused on Applied Behavior Analysis Major in Illinois. The Chicago School Chicago Campus is a small school located in Chicago, Illinois that handed out 2 doctorate’s applied behavior analysis degrees in 2021-2022.
The school has an impressive undergrad student loan default rate. It’s only 0.6%, which is much lower than the national rate of 10.1%. Since the school has a undergrad student-to-faculty ratio of 8 to 1, those pursuing a degree will have more opportunities to interact with their professors.
